According to SavingCountryMusic, there could be a Luke Bryan and Miley Cyrus duet on the horizon and fans are not exactly thrilled. Though no one from either Luke nor Miley's camp has confirmed the story, it could happen and some fans are calling it the apocalypse. (Turns out that fans have a long memory and not many have forgotten Cyrus calling country music "contrived on so many levels" and saying that an artist has to be wearing a "cowboy hat and cowboy boots and singing and whining about your girlfriend or boyfriend leaving you" in order to be successful in a Parade Magazine interview in 2010.)

Would a duet between the two be a smart move for either? While it would potentially open up a new demographic for Luke with Miley's fans, if comments found online are indication, it wouldn't be applauded by Luke's fans. It's a good thing that Luke himself appears to know that fact. Apparently, the guy who loves a good joke/prank was caught off guard by this bit of news and he's taken to Twitter to let fans know that this "confirmed" (by two radio personalities) newsflash is someone's pipe dream (but not his.)

On his official Twitter, Bryan asked, "Why is everyone asking if I'm doing a duet with miley." He followed that one minute later with, "Not true."
